What is an Elliptical?

An elliptical trainer, also known as a cross-trainer, is a stationary exercise machine used to simulate stair climbing, walking, or running without causing excessive pressure to the joints, hence decreasing the risk of impact injuries. It provides a non-impact cardiovascular workout that engages both the upper and lower body simultaneously.

Understanding the Elliptical Machine

An elliptical machine is a popular piece of cardio equipment found in most gyms and many home fitness setups. Its defining characteristic is the elliptical motion of the foot pedals, which allows the user's feet to move in a smooth, elongated circular path, mimicking a natural walking or running stride without the jarring impact associated with traditional ground-based activities.

Key components of an elliptical include:

  • Foot pedals: These move in an elliptical path, supporting the user's feet throughout the entire stride.
  • Handlebars: Often dual-action, these move in conjunction with the foot pedals, allowing for synchronized upper-body engagement.
  • Resistance mechanism: Typically magnetic, allowing users to adjust the intensity of the workout.
  • Incline ramp (on some models): Allows for changes in the steepness of the elliptical path, targeting different muscle groups.

Key Biomechanical Principles

The design of the elliptical trainer is rooted in principles that prioritize joint health and comprehensive muscle activation.

  • Low-Impact Nature: Unlike running or jumping, the user's feet remain in constant contact with the pedals. This eliminates the repetitive ground reaction forces that can stress joints like the knees, hips, and ankles. The continuous, gliding motion minimizes the eccentric loading on the joints, making it ideal for individuals with orthopedic concerns or those seeking a gentler exercise option.
  • Full-Body Engagement: The synchronized movement of the foot pedals and handlebars encourages a reciprocal motion that mimics natural human gait. This allows for simultaneous activation of both the lower body (pushing and pulling the pedals) and the upper body (pushing and pulling the handlebars), leading to a more complete workout.
  • Mimicry of Natural Movement: The elliptical path is designed to closely resemble the natural stride pattern of walking or running, promoting efficient muscle recruitment and coordination without the harsh impact.

Primary Benefits of Elliptical Training

Integrating elliptical training into your fitness regimen offers a range of significant advantages for overall health and performance.

  • Enhanced Cardiovascular Health: As an aerobic exercise, elliptical training effectively elevates heart rate, strengthens the heart muscle, improves circulation, and enhances lung capacity. Consistent use contributes to a reduced risk of cardiovascular diseases.
  • Joint-Friendly Workout: The hallmark benefit of the elliptical is its low-impact nature. It provides an excellent cardiovascular challenge without the repetitive stress on weight-bearing joints, making it suitable for individuals with arthritis, joint pain, or those recovering from certain lower-body injuries.
  • Effective Calorie Expenditure: Depending on intensity, duration, and resistance, elliptical workouts can burn a substantial number of calories, making them an effective tool for weight management and body composition improvements.
  • Comprehensive Muscle Engagement:
    • Lower Body: Primarily targets the quadriceps, hamstrings, glutes, and calves. Adjusting resistance and incline can emphasize different muscle groups.
    • Upper Body: The moving handlebars engage the biceps, triceps, shoulders, and back muscles (latissimus dorsi, rhomboids) through pushing and pulling actions.
    • Core: Maintaining an upright posture and stable torso throughout the movement engages the core musculature, contributing to improved stability and balance.
  • Improved Balance and Coordination: The synchronized, multi-limb movement required on an elliptical helps to enhance proprioception (the body's sense of position in space) and overall coordination.
  • Versatility in Training: Most ellipticals allow for forward and backward pedaling, varying resistance levels, and often adjustable incline ramps. This versatility enables users to target different muscle groups, prevent plateaus, and add variety to their workouts.

Who Can Benefit from Elliptical Training?

Given its unique design and benefits, the elliptical trainer is a versatile piece of equipment suitable for a wide range of individuals:

  • Individuals Seeking Low-Impact Cardio: Excellent for those who experience joint pain during high-impact activities like running.
  • Beginners to Exercise: The intuitive motion and supported nature make it less intimidating than some other cardio machines.
  • Individuals Recovering from Certain Injuries: Often recommended for rehabilitation due to its joint-friendly nature (always consult with a physical therapist or medical professional).
  • Those Aiming for Full-Body Workouts: Ideal for maximizing calorie burn and muscle engagement in a single session.
  • Older Adults: Provides a safe and effective way to maintain cardiovascular health and mobility without undue stress on aging joints.

Considerations and Potential Drawbacks

While highly beneficial, it's important to be aware of certain considerations when incorporating elliptical training into your routine.

  • Less Bone Loading: Because it's a non-impact exercise, the elliptical does not provide the same level of bone-loading stimulus as weight-bearing activities like running or jumping. For individuals prioritizing bone density improvement, supplementing with resistance training or higher-impact activities (if appropriate) is recommended.
  • Limited Sport-Specific Training: While it mimics gait, the elliptical does not fully replicate the ground reaction forces or specific movement patterns required for certain sports. Athletes training for specific events may need to incorporate sport-specific drills.
  • Potential for Improper Form: Users may lean on the handlebars too heavily, slouch, or rely disproportionately on their arms or legs. This can reduce the effectiveness of the workout and potentially lead to discomfort.
  • Perceived Monotony: Some individuals may find the repetitive motion of the elliptical less engaging than outdoor activities or other forms of exercise. Varying workouts with incline, resistance, and interval training can help mitigate this.

Optimizing Your Elliptical Workout

To maximize the benefits and ensure safety, proper form and strategic programming are crucial:

  • Maintain Proper Posture: Stand tall with your chest up, shoulders relaxed and back, and core engaged. Avoid leaning forward or slouching. Look straight ahead, not down at your feet.
  • Engage the Whole Body: Actively push and pull the handlebars while simultaneously driving through your heels on the foot pedals. Aim for a balanced effort between your upper and lower body.
  • Vary Resistance and Incline: Don't stick to the same settings. Increase resistance to build strength and muscle endurance. Utilize the incline feature (if available) to target glutes and hamstrings more effectively and simulate hill climbing.
  • Incorporate Interval Training: Alternate periods of high intensity with periods of lower intensity recovery. This can significantly boost cardiovascular fitness and calorie expenditure.
  • Listen to Your Body: Pay attention to any pain or discomfort. Adjust your form, resistance, or duration as needed. Consult a professional if pain persists.
